Anna Spackman grew up in Chester Springs, Pennsylvania with a piano and a head full of musical whimsy. A couple of years after a guitar entered her life, these ideas began spilling out of her mouth and ears like stars, and she has been working ever since to try to turn them into songs. People have said they are reminiscent of Ani Difranco, Joni Mitchell and Feist - Anna simply hopes that they say something helpful occasionally, and linger in your ear for a little while.
.
She is now at Lewis and Clark College out in Oregon, so watch for her at Portland open mics.
